A long-term, effective solution to help prevent uncomfortable, irritating, painful hemorrhoids is to merely adopt a high-fiber diet. A hemorrhoid prevention diet centered around high fiber content should contain foods like oatmeals, whole grain pasta and breads, as well as leafy green vegetables. Bowel motility thrives with regular fiber, and a lot of fiber also reduces the straining that encourages hemorrhoids to form.

Rutin is an ingredient that can take for hemorrhoids. Weak blood vessels can be the chief cause hemorrhoids. Rutin is a flavonoid that is essential for the absorption of Vitamin C and also strengthens blood vessels. The supplementary recommended daily is 500mg in supplement form.
If you are suffering from hemorrhoids, it is wise to avoid using personal care products that have irritants, such as dyes, scents or essential oils, on the area surrounding your hemorrhoids. These products will sting and make the swelling and itching even worse.

During bowel movements, straining too hard can cause hemorrhoids. Stools will move more freely if you absorb large quantities of water and maintain a diet that is low in refined foods. The need to strain will also be lessened if you squat during bowel movements. One way to acquire the best body positioning is to use a small stool to rest your feet while you are seated in the bathroom. In certain places in the world, people squat when having a bowel movement. It is in these locations that people rarely suffer from hemorrhoids.

While hemorrhoids are most likely the cause, you should always consult with your doctor. Blood in your stool can be a symptom of many serious health problems, even cancer. Get diagnosed by a doctor so you can stop worrying.
